diff -Nru puppet-module-puppetlabs-haproxy-2.1.0/debian/changelog puppet-module-puppetlabs-haproxy-2.1.0/debian/changelog --- puppet-module-puppetlabs-haproxy-2.1.0/debian/changelog 2021-04-17 09:58:30.000000000 +0000 +++ puppet-module-puppetlabs-haproxy-2.1.0/debian/changelog 2022-01-04 16:24:44.000000000 +0000 @@ -1,3 +1,9 @@ +puppet-module-puppetlabs-haproxy (2.1.0-4) unstable; urgency=medium + + * Clean up update-alternatives handling (Closes: #989237). + + -- Thomas Goirand Tue, 04 Jan 2022 17:24:44 +0100 + puppet-module-puppetlabs-haproxy (2.1.0-3) unstable; urgency=medium * Fix update-alternatives --remove in prerm. diff -Nru pu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.postrm pu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.postrm --- pu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.postrm 2021-04-17 09:58:30.000000000 +0000 +++ pu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.postrm 2022-01-04 16:24:44.000000000 +0000 @@ -2,7 +2,7 @@ set -e -if [ "${1}" = "remove" ] || [ "${1}" = "disappear" ]; then +if [ "${1}" = "remove" ] ; then update-alternatives --remove puppet-module-haproxy /usr/share/puppet/modules.available/puppetlabs-haproxy fi diff -Nru pu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.prerm pu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.prerm --- pu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.prerm 2021-04-17 09:58:30.000000000 +0000 +++ puppet-module-puppetlabs-haproxy-2.1.0/debian/puppet-module-puppetlabs-haproxy.prerm 2022-01-04 16:24:44.000000000 +0000 @@ -2,7 +2,7 @@ set -e -if [ "${1}" = "remove" ] || [ "${1}" = "upgrade" ] || [ "${1}" = "deconfigure" ] ; then +if [ "${1}" = "remove" ] ; then update-alternatives --remove puppet-module-haproxy /usr/share/puppet/modules.available/puppetlabs-haproxy fi